1Dutzan et al. [29]
Journal of Periodontology, 2011
“Levels of Interleukin-21 in Patients with Untreated Chronic Periodontitis”
Case control studyGroup 1: controls,
Group 2: CP,
PI, PD, CAL, PI, BOP, and presence of IL-21Gingival and GCF IL-21 (healthy-extraction site, CP- periodontal lesions) were analysed by IHC and Western blot (for presence of IL-21) and quantification was done by ELISAUnpaired -test and Mann-Whitney test
Chi square test
Gingival IL-21 levels were significantly higher in CP group (3.35 pg/mg) than in controls (0.98 pg/mg) ()
Frequency of GCF IL-21 was greater in CP patients (8/10) than in controls (2/10)  ()
The Western blot and IHC staining confirmed the presence of IL-21 in periodontal tissues and GCF

4Dutzan et al. [31]
Journal of Periodontology, 2012
“Interleukin-21 Expression and Its Association with Proinflammatory
Cytokines in Untreated Chronic Periodontitis subjects”
Case control studyGroup 1: controls,
Group 2: CP,
IL-21 mRNA level Gingival IL-21 (healthy-extraction site, CP- periodontal lesions) was analysed using RT-PCR The RQ expressed as fold change for each studied cytokine
Spearman rank correlation test
A significant overexpression of IL-21 in CP affected tissues compared to healthy gingival tissues (120-fold)
Significant positive correlations of IL-21 with PD (0.71)  () and CAL (0.60)  ()
